Output fba86575343f28a7feb789e86992afd536dacc3984b612254de9c10489946636:2

value
37300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dab9ba9e690598469d4830aa6083d422cd36b57 OP_EQUALVERIFY OP_CHECKSIG
address
13htB6p7APZA5SPSFMN4iLchvuJbYC6bBL
transaction
fba86575343f28a7feb789e86992afd536dacc3984b612254de9c10489946636
spent
true